Frommer's Review
Formerly Clarence Chadwick's 330-acre copra plantation, this exclusive establishment is the premier property on these two islands. It's one of the best choices in South Florida for serious tennis buffs. Its Gulf-side golf course is one of the most picturesque 9-holers anywhere, and its two marinas host scuba-dive operators. The resort occupies all of Captiva's northern third, making it ideal if you want to step from your luxury house or condominium right onto 2 1/2 miles of gorgeous beach. The resort is so spread out that a free trolley shuttles back and forth through the mangrove forests. In 2005 it underwent a whopping $140-million renovation in which rooms -- from standard hotel rooms to one-, two-, and three-bedroom beach villas and private homes -- were done up in a soothingly swank West Indies decor. Other enhancements include a souped-up pool area with two new lagoon-style pools, private luxury cabanas with DVD players, plasma TVs, cabana stewards, a redesigned golf course, and new bars and restaurants. The resort's no-cash, charge-to-your-room policy prevents gate-crashers from entering the resort proper. Activities are stellar and include day cruises to Cabbage Key and Useppa, as well as specialty trips for shelling, dolphin watching, and sunset viewing. In addition to the Harbourside Grill with views of the harbor, due to arrive in late 2007 are a sushi bar, ice cream parlor, and pizzeria.
Facilities:3 restaurants; 2 bars; 18 heated outdoor pools; 9-hole golf course; 18 tennis courts; health club; Jacuzzis; watersports equipment rental; bike rental; children's programs; game room; concierge; activities desk; business center; shopping arcade; salon; limited room service; massage; babysitting; laundry service; coin-op washers and dryers
